South Korea cuts base rates by 25bps first time in 12 months

June 10, 2016 (LBO) – South Korea’s central bank yesterday decided to cut the base rate by 25 basis points to 1.25 percent amid risks to growth from domestic and international markets. South Asia developing 7.1 pct; Sri Lanka falling behind on debt, growth

June 10, 2016 (LBO) – Growth in South Asia is expected to reach 7.1 percent in 2016 and strengthen to 7.3 percent by 2018, underpinned by robust domestic demand, the World Bank said in its Global Economic Prospects report. Sri Lanka Ports Authority calls EOIs to develop East Container Terminal

June 09, 2016 (LBO) – The Sri Lanka Ports Authority has invited expressions of interest to develop the East Container Terminal of the Colombo Port on a build operate transfer (BOT) basis. India plans expanded missile export drive, with China on its mind

June 9 (Reuters) – India has stepped up efforts to sell an advanced cruise missile system to Vietnam and has at least 15 more markets in its sights, a push experts say reflects concerns in New Delhi about China’s growing military assertiveness.
